Introduction to FNAF Gameplay

The core gameplay of FNAF involves monitoring a network of cameras and closing doors to prevent animatronic characters, like Freddy, from entering the player’s office. The game is divided into nights, each representing a shift as a security guard at Freddy Fazbear’s Pizza, a fictional family restaurant. The player must conserve power, as excessive use of lights, doors, and other systems will lead to a game over. Each night increases in difficulty, with the animatronics becoming more aggressive and harder to detect.
Understanding Animatronic Behavior
Freddy Fazbear, along with the other animatronics (Bonnie the Bunny, Chica the Chicken, and Foxy the Pirate Fox), has unique behaviors and patterns. For instance, Freddy is known for his unpredictability and ability to move quickly and quietly. Understanding these behaviors is crucial for survival, as it allows players to anticipate and prepare for potential attacks. Utilizing the audio cues, such as the sound of the animatronics moving, can also aid in tracking their locations and movements.

Strategies for Survival

Survival in FNAF requires a combination of strategic planning, timely reactions, and a bit of luck. Here are a few strategies that can increase the chances of making it through all five nights:
- Conserving Power: Use lights and doors judiciously. Keeping the doors closed can prevent animatronics from entering but also consumes power. Finding a balance between security and power conservation is key.
- Monitoring Cameras: Regularly check the cameras to track the animatronics' movements. This is especially important for detecting Foxy's activity in the pirate cove.
- Audio Cues: Pay attention to the sounds made by the animatronics. These can provide early warnings of potential attacks, allowing for proactive measures to be taken.
Uncovering the Lore
Beyond the gameplay, the FNAF series is renowned for its complex and mysterious lore. The games are filled with subtle hints and clues that, when pieced together, reveal a dark history surrounding Freddy Fazbear’s Pizza and the creation of the animatronics. The series explores themes of tragedy, loss, and the consequences of playing with forces beyond human control. Understanding the lore can deepen the player’s appreciation for the game’s universe and its terrifying characters.
One of the central mysteries revolves around the events that led to the downfall of Freddy Fazbear's Pizza. Through various phone calls, news articles, and hidden messages within the games, players can uncover a narrative of child abductions, murders, and the eventual closure of the restaurant. The animatronics, once designed to entertain children, became vessels for the vengeful spirits of the victims, leading to the horrific events that players experience firsthand.
